The IP (Ingress Protection) rating describes the box's ability to resist dust and water. For outdoor distribution boxes, selecting a box with a high IP rating is crucial. For example, an IP65-rated box is completely dust-tight and can withstand water spray, making it ideal for outdoor use. Unlike standard junction boxes, these distribution systems must.     Home distribution boxes typically handle single-phase power supplies and contain 6 to 24 circuits. They include standard circuit breakers for lighting, outlets, and major appliances like water heaters and air conditioning units. And all the switching and protective devices are installed in the distribution box.
